The Framework of Dental Treatment in Canada
Oral care in Canada functions greatly outside the openly funded medical care unit. While health care services are actually dealt with under the Canada Health and wellness Act, dental companies are predominantly supplied via private centers spent by individuals or employer-sponsored insurance plannings. This means that access to dental care often depends on job standing, profit level, or even rural aid courses.
The federal authorities, through Wellness Canada, engages in a minimal yet necessary role in financing targeted oral systems for certain populations, like children, senior citizens in low-income brackets, and also Aboriginal neighborhoods. Get access to and also Inequality in Oral Health And Wellness
Among one of the most notable problems in Canadian dental treatment is actually inequality in accessibility. Surveys consistently present that a sizable section of Canadians stay clear of oral check outs due to set you back. Low-income houses, particularly, skin obstacles that result in without treatment tooth cavities, gum tissue disease, and various other preventable disorders.
Little ones and senior citizens are actually particularly at risk. While some provinces provide minimal protection for children from low-income loved ones, qualifications standards vary widely. Seniors, most of whom live on repaired incomes, may likewise struggle to manage regular dental upkeep, leading to falling apart dental health over time.
These disparities possess broader health and wellness effects. Poor oral health is connected to heart disease, diabetic issues difficulties, and lessened lifestyle. Despite this, oral care has in the past been alleviated as optionally available rather than necessary in public health plan conversations.
The Canadian Dental Treatment Strategy: A Plan Shift
In feedback to growing problems about price as well as get access to, the federal government launched the Canadian Dental Care Plan. This project represents one of one of the most substantial growths of publicly supported oral coverage in Canadian past history.
The system strives to provide dental coverage for without insurance Canadians along with household revenues listed below a pointed out limit. Solutions dealt with generally consist of preventative treatment like cleansings and also exams, along with standard restorative techniques like dental fillings. As time go on, the program is actually expected to broaden its range and also arrive at additional people.
This development mirrors a broader plan work schedule towards identifying dental health and wellness as an important component of standard health. Through lowering economic obstacles, the course looks for to strengthen early discovery of oral concerns and also lower long-lasting healthcare costs linked with neglected oral condition.
Provincial Variant and also System Intricacy
Another defining attribute of dental treatment in Canada is the variation all over provinces and also areas. Hospital distribution in Canada is decentralized, meaning each province creates its own supplemental dental programs.
As an example, some provinces give free or sponsored oral look after children under specific grow older thresholds, while others provide minimal emergency situation dental companies for social help recipients. This jumble unit may make complication for locals as well as unequal gain access to depending on geographical area.
Rural as well as remote areas encounter added obstacles. In some areas, there is actually a shortage of oral experts, needing individuals to travel fars away for treatment. Indigenous areas, in particular, typically experience notable gaps in access, despite targeted government courses.
Technological Innovation as well as Modern Dentistry
Regardless of building obstacles, Canadian oral care has benefited from considerable technological and clinical improvements. Digital radiography, laser dental care, as well as improved materials for fillings and crowns have improved therapy high quality as well as client comfort.
Tele-dentistry is likewise emerging as a resource to boost accessibility, especially in remote areas. Via digital appointments, dentists can easily offer initial examinations, triage immediate scenarios, and resource clients on whether in-person treatment is actually necessary.
These advancements are actually assisting to unite some voids in accessibility, but they can certainly not fully change the demand for physical professional solutions. Because of this, policy reform continues to be main to enhancing equity in dental wellness outcomes.
